WebSep 12, 2024 · The equation for the energy associated with SHM can be solved to find the magnitude of the velocity at any position: \[ v = \sqrt{\frac{k}{m} (A^{2} - x^{2})} \ldotp … WebThe force applied by a spring on a mass is given by the model F_spring = –kx. "k" is called the spring constant and it is a measure of the stiffness of the spring. "x" is the displacement of the spring from its equilibrium position. WebFor a simple harmonic oscillator, an object’s cycle of motion can be described by the equation x (t) = A\cos (2\pi f t) x(t) =Acos(2πf t), where the amplitude is independent of the period. WebApr 10, 2024 · The velocity of a particle in SHM is expressed as; v = ω √(a 2 – y 2) At the mean position y = 0 and v is maximum. So, the maximum velocity is expressed as v max = aω; At the extreme positions, displacement is the same as magnitude. So, y = a and v is zero. The total energy is the sum of the kinetic and elastic potential energy of a simple harmonic oscillator: E=K+U_s E = K +U s. The total energy of the oscillator is constant in the absence of friction. When one type of energy decreases, the other increases to maintain the same total energy.
